well after 3 days of great racing and good times on duval, things seem quite here. i didn't want to continue the "fury thread" since that was orginally meant to show what guy was doing in Trinidad, but would like to start a new one on the situtation on some how combining the 750,850 and class 1 boats. atleast in my opion, those races with the above classes all in one start put on one of the best shows of the day. i might even go as far as the best racing of the week.

so after seeing the class one guys run and CRC run second to them, Tony, whats your thought on making changes to bring the classes closer ? i heard rumors that the Qatar might bring one boat back or both. appearently the both the 750's and 850's need some work to run with the class one guys but not much to get them to stay in a pack. any thoughts on modifing the 750 or 850 rules now before next season. i don't see the org's changing anything as far as consolidating these classes. so that leaves it up to the racers.

and also with Class 1 announcing a race in Rio (south america) and possibly the bahamas this might be the time to jump on board with similar rules so that the US teams could be invited to run with class one and have "legal" boats that would fight in with the Class one rules.

It will be harder than you think. Class 1 is pretty much unlimited money, high compression motors, lambo sterling etc.

Im not a rules expert but I believe the 750/850 have tons of rules, rev limiters etc. The class 1 guys will not change there stuff the 750/850 guys will have to change. The boats are pretty much the same.

Maybe change the rules to allow more Hp or something.

Open class motors are expensive, and it will require diff props gears etc.

Not a cheap idea.

HHMM maybe we will show up for all 3 races next year..Anyways ball is rolling, Ive had a couple of conversations with Steve and Tom to outline some gudelines we can start with. They are very interested in racing here next year if we can work together on this whole class. They are very knowledgeable on costs and parity they think we can obtain. I have to say I think this is the best group of people to really unite the whole deal. "people" I mean all of us.

Just a couple things to brew on:

1. The 750 boat are in fact the slowest of the 3. The 850
will probably use an air restrictor that is already
available.

2. The lambo boat will reduce Rpm. We can also use
weight in the future.

3. We need to know who is all in. This we way can make
some small adjustsments over the winter for certain
boats "individually".

4. I have spoke to Abrams and Steve about getting some
boats together and doing some acceleration and top
speed tests during the winter. This will give us a
baseline.

5. We will come up with a set of rules and we will give to
the Org. at the races to fully tech at each site.

6. Steve is looking at race sites as he gets them to
determine where his team would "like" to go for the
maximum exposure for our class. We should do the
same.

Lastly, we will build a small private forum that we can all chat on certain topics on SUPERCATRACING.com.
